Time

The Instituto Superior Técnico is a founding member of the TIME programme. Initially composed of 16 founding Members, there are today more than 40 European Technical Universities that participate in this network. 

Under this programme, students can obtain a Double Diploma, through IST and through the home University, as long as there is a bilateral agreement celebrated with IST. 

The requirements for a student to apply to the TIME programme are as follows: 

  • Students, who have completed their 1st Cycle;
  • Studies leading to Double Diploma will have a duration of three years (instead of two), totalling 180 ECTS credits;
  • The three years of studies will be divided as follows: one year spent in the home institution and two years in the host institution, according to a plan defined jointly by the home and host institutions;
  • The student should prepare, present an defend a final dissertation;
  • The host university will appoint a tutor for each student for the duration of the study period.
